IP address 62.187.3.194 lookup, whois and location finder

IP address  62.187.3.194
62.187.3.194  Germany
IPv4
62.187.3.194
AT&T Global Network Services Nederland B.V.
AT&T Global Network Services Nederland B.V.
62.187.3.192 - 62.187.3.239
Europe/Berlin (UTC+2)
Germany 
Nordrhein-Westfalen
not determined
51.450000762939, 7.0166997909546
Show
Connection type corporate
IP on map